About this earthquake

A magnitude M2.6 earthquake was recorded near Malasej (Albania) on August 24, 2026 at 08:24 UTC. With a focal depth of about 10 km, this was a shallow earthquake, whose shaking is usually felt more strongly at the surface. Earthquakes of this small magnitude are usually barely noticeable and cause no damage.

The data is provided by EMSC and cross-checked across seismological networks. Albania: 2 earthquakes were recorded in the past 24 hours, the strongest reaching M2.6.
